WHO WE ARE:

State of Franklin Healthcare Associates is a physician-led and team-member-owned multi-specialty care group headquartered in Johnson City, TN with locations in the upper East Tennessee & Southwest Virginia region.  Our mission is to improve the health and well-being of our patients and our team members.

 

PRIMARY R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Perform ultrasound and other procedures on patients as directed by physicians and advanced practitioners
  • Routine and complex studies
  • Assist physicians in a variety of imaging procedures
  • Perform on all age groups from infants to adult/geriatric
  • Organize processed images, measurements, calculations, and other data for physicians to interpret
  • Maintain equipment and order/stock all ultrasound supplies
  • Maintain department records, reports, and files
  • Maintain continuing education requirements

 

REQUIREMENTS:

  • Degree in Radiology Technology from an accredited institution; Registered ARRT by the American Registry of Diagnostic Medical Sonographers

 

EXPERIENCE:

  • One year experience in sonography applications

 

CERTIFICATES, LICENSES, REGISTRATIONS:

  • Basic Life Support (BLS) certification
  • Registry or registry eligible with the American Registry of Diagnostic Medical Sonographers (ARDMS)
  • Registered Vascular Technologist (RVT) by ARDMS preferred
  • Registered by the American Registry of Radiology Technology (ARRT)
